I'm a bit confused by the WDWNT post about stacking passes. Unless I'm reading it wrong, it says they got their first pass at 7am for SDD (they go quickly if you can get 3pm+ slots at 7am!), and then the next was 2 hours after park opening, so 11am, rather than 9am which would be 2 hours after the first selection. Then the following ones at 1pm and 3pm. So, if that's right, when trying to stack for an sfternoon/evening visit, the second one is 2 hours after park opening?

Kinda explained above, but I'll illustrate with an example...
Say you visit the Magic Kingdom at rope drop and blitz the rides for a few hours. You leave the park at 1 to head back to your hotel for a swim. As you do so, you make a LL reservation for Big Thunder at 6pm. At 3pm (ie 1pm when you made the last reservation plus 2 hours) you can make another so, back at your hotel, you make a reservation for Pirates at 7pm. At 5pm (ie 3pm when you made the last reservation plus 2 hours) you can make another so, back at your hotel, you make a reservation for Peter Pan at 8pm. So you return to the park in the evening with three reservations waiting for you, and knowing that at 7pm you can make yet another. |
